About World Computer Exchange Chapters
World Computer Exchange depends on chapter volunteers to help us accomplish our mission. Volunteers help:
-
Raise Sponsorship funds to help WCE Partners with the last 1/3 of the sourcing and shipping costs (this includes Rotary Clubs)
-
Coordinate marketing for public computer donation events, eCorps recruitment, volunteer recruitment, speakers bureau, and press releases for shipments
-
Pick-up, inventory, test and pack donated used computers
-
Recruit eCorps tech volunteers from local universities and community and organize Speakers Bureau and work with local universities and high schools on community service, pairings, interns
-
Recruit, organize and nurture volunteers to help with Chapter & field work including for eWaste, eCorps, and capacity building
